Transaction 93efa083226b3f155208287d6582120a983ba47d46f2e29739ae3593a5ba51ac
1 Input
1 Output
-
93efa083226b3f155208287d6582120a983ba47d46f2e29739ae3593a5ba51ac:0
- value
- 103870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2111bbec3385cf9e207f01bba62f021830f9208 OP_EQUAL
- address
- 3GTwtLArfsz5oAyegzPECbVgX9vvk7v4gs